Transaction 954392103c2731ca3949a54358a6162d3fb129793130899e5663e8ff694978be

1 Input
2 Outputs
  • 954392103c2731ca3949a54358a6162d3fb129793130899e5663e8ff694978be:0
  • value  102620
    address  1NHq3MtCy4sP3jGRNBMnmSpPvtLmKycmFm
  • 954392103c2731ca3949a54358a6162d3fb129793130899e5663e8ff694978be:1
  • value  64487499
    address  182dLwtho6KZ1WYnd2ehxEG72TDU28cHid